Building vibrant local economies is the first in the CHAMPIONING THE LOCAL series of SEDA Land Conversations.

Scottish Ecological Design Association (SEDA) will explore alternative business models, including co-operatives, social enterprises and employee-owned businesses, and how they can make LVC’s possible, as well as the best scale at which such issues can be addressed – local, regional or national.

At present, Scotland has plenty of micro examples of Inclusive and Democratic Business Models (IDBMs). This talk will look at ways of scaling these up, and rolling them out across the country, in areas such as food, renewable energy and retrofit.

One aim is to highlight the interconnectedness of all these issues, and how thinking about them together brings wider benefits, with different sectors learning from each other.

This Conversation will include inspirational models, using these as a springboard for a broader discussion of the subject, addressing obstacles along the way and how to overcome them.
